Today is March twelfth and we're going to talk about two organisms that can cause skin infections and are transmitted from animals. And ironically, one more reason why dogs are better than cats. I swear I didn't plan it this way, please don't at me.

High-yield microbiology review for medical boards step 1, and two boards-style practice questions
